Buying vs. Hiring Shipping containers are among the most versatile pieces of equipment on the market, offering short – and long-term storage as well transportation solutions. They are also strong and resistant to weather which makes them ideal for a wide range of applications. It's crucial to take into account your budget and individual needs when deciding whether to buy or lease. A container purchase can be more expensive in the beginning however it's a great option if you plan to use it for a long period of time. A container purchase comes with maintenance obligations that include regular inspections of the container for damage and weathering. If you intend to use your container in a marine environment for instance you may have to purchase an anti-corrosion treatment. It is also important to think about whether you'll need to alter the container to meet specific requirements. The overall functionality of your container will be improved by adding additional ventilation and insulation, as well as ply the lining. The option of leasing a container is much cheaper option. This is especially true if you only need the container for a brief duration, such as moving or renovating. Additionally leasing a container gives you more flexibility when it comes to disposal. The option of leasing or renting a shipping container will be less expensive than purchasing one directly. It also allows for greater flexibility as you can hire them for days, weeks or even months at an time. This is ideal for those who are moving and require a place to store their belongings until they find an appropriate home. Shipping containers are also very durable and weatherproof, so they can be used for long-term storage.
